    The latest entrant in the "world's shortest" category is Indian Jyoti Amge.

    Ms Amge measures 62.8cm (or 24.7 inches) and has a condition called achondroplasia, a form of dwarfism.


    Like many of the title holders she is proud with the award.


    "I feel grateful to be this size, after all if I weren't small and had not achieved these world records I might never have been able to visit Japan and Europe, and many other wonderful countries," she said.
